In this video we show you how to change and adjust your airbrush’s needle packing using the screw drivers included with the Iwata Professional Maintenance Tools Set.
The Needle Packing Set (sometimes called a seal), is an important airbrush component as it prevents paint from traveling from the color cup into the airbrush body.
We include two sizes of Needle Packing Screw Drivers with the Maintenance Tools, so you can use them with any Iwata airbrush.

Before disconnecting your airbrush from the air hose:
1. Make sure your compressor is off.
2. Then hold down the main lever to release any stored air.

Thanks for this video I've been wondering since I got my brush how the needle is sealed. How long between replacing packings is typical? I'd figure several years is normal life.
Wondering where to get that screwdriver lol
Thank you for watching the video! To answer your question- unless an airbrush is soaked in solvents (which we do not recommend) it is unlikely the needle packing will need to be replaced. It is more common that users will want to adjust the packing for more or less tension in the movement of the needle and these screw drivers are the perfect tools to make those adjustments.

Hi, if I buy a neo or eclipse could I use Universal needles or nozzles? or does it have to be from IWATA? I live in a place where I can't find replacement parts online.
There is no universal sizing among airbrushes. Needles and nozzles have different lengths, tapers and diameters and impact performance of the individual brush. For this reason, we recommend only using the recommended replacement parts specifically for the brand and model of the brush or performance may be impacted.
